Guias
Cuando se usa
Cuando una factura se emite con metodoPago: "PPD" (Pago en Parcialidades
o Diferido), necesitas emitir un Complemento de Pago (REP 2.0) por cada
pago que recibas.
Flujo
- Emitir factura original con
metodoPago: "PPD"yformaPago: "99" - Cuando recibes un pago, generar el REP vinculado a la factura original
- Si hay pagos parciales, generar un REP por cada pago
Registrar un pago
curl -X POST https://api.timbrify.com/api/v1/merchant/payments \
-H "Cookie: tmb_session=TU_SESSION" \
-H "Content-Type: application/json" \
-d '{
"invoiceId": "uuid-factura-ppd",
"fechaPago": "2026-04-01",
"formaPago": "03",
"monto": 2500.00,
"moneda": "MXN"
}'Formas de pago comunes
| Codigo | Descripcion |
|---|---|
| 01 | Efectivo |
| 02 | Cheque nominativo |
| 03 | Transferencia electronica |
| 04 | Tarjeta de credito |
| 28 | Tarjeta de debito |
| 99 | Por definir (solo para factura PPD) |
Timbrify genera automaticamente el XML del REP 2.0
con la estructura Pagos20 que requiere el SAT,
incluyendo los documentos relacionados y saldos.